Screaming Females

Rose Mountain

2016-11-28

I always love listening to something that is different. I have to say i thought the girls voice was just about a Carbon Copy of Gwen Stefani from No Doubt or what have you. The music is pretty similar to, but a little more Indie. The Guitar licks however, just flat out stand out by themselves, and are AWESOME to say the least. With this being their second album you can certainly see how they dialed it back versus their debut. This one is a little more towards the softer side for sure. You can also see how the vocals have changed too, as their previous album had a completely different style to it.
